    I’m going to combine concepts here. Since I fear Wesker will return and reclaim Scarface, I wish to repurpose Sugar, the second Ventriloquist.

    I also wish to revive the duo of Sugar & Spice from the Batman Forever movie; I liked their scenes. Sugar would be persuasion and Spice would be intimidation.

    To this pair, I will add a third…a doll to replace Scarface; a possessed dolly (...they quite popular in movies). You never see her move; no one sees her move… she moves. Her eyes sometimes glow…but they are made of light reflective material. You can hear a little girl’s laughter…but only you heard it. Bad things happen; misfortune favors the opponents of Sugar & Spice. I’m talking a little bad luck not an ancient curse here – unless someone is trying to do serious harm to Sugar and/or Spice; then, Watch Out! (It will slow the heroes down but does not stop them.) Done right, I think this could add a creepy atmosphere to the story as well as give S&S an edge.

    Spellbinder - Faye Moffit should make a return. Her illusion-casting and hypnotic powers make for a powerful threat to Gothamites. My story for her is she commits crimes by casting the illusion of other villains and henchmen perpetrating the crime - creating a mystery of who is actually behind the crimes.

    She turns into a much more shadowy figure that runs afoul of not only the Batfamily, but the villains' visages she exploits on the Gothamites terrified of those villains.

    Another example where a B or C List villain needs an upgrade in how they're handled to become a bigger threat to Gotham.
